Vila Cova da Lixa e Borba de Godim officially came into existence on January 28, 2013. This was part of a national administrative reform. The union brought together two distinct freguesias. Vila Cova da Lixa became the seat of this new entity.

Before the merger, Vila Cova da Lixa was an independent freguesia. It had a unique identity within Felgueiras. Borba de Godim also contributed its history and traditions. United, they formed a stronger, more cohesive community.
The numbers tell a story of their own. In 2021, Vila Cova da Lixa e Borba de Godim had 6,081 inhabitants. The area covers 13.46 square kilometers. This gives a population density of 451.8 inhabitants per square kilometer.

Before the union in 2011, Vila Cova da Lixa alone had 3,850 residents. It had a population density of 673.1 inhabitants per square kilometer. These figures highlight the area’s demographic changes over time.

The Igreja do Santíssimo Salvador de Vila Cova da Lixa stands as a landmark. It represents the area’s religious heritage. It is a testament to the enduring faith of its people.
